Warner Home Video has announced 'The Wizard of Oz: Emerald Edition' for release on Blu-ray on December 1. When Victor Fleming's classic was released on September 29, this three-disc, no-frills set was originally a retailer exclusive, available only at Target stores. Now all bricks-and-mortar and Internet retailers will be able to stock it.
As we explained during release week on the
Wizard of Oz buying guide, the Emerald Edition is comprised of three discs, and contains all the disc-based contents from the
Ultimate Collector's Edition, including the six-hour MGM documentary "When the Lion Roars", but not the digital copy, or any of the collectibles.
This edition carries an MSRP of $49.99, or $35 less than the Ultimate Collector's Edition.
